First and foremost, it is essential to understand what low modulus neutral cure silicone is and how it differs from other types of silicone sealants. Low modulus refers to the flexibility and elasticity of the material, meaning that LMNCS has a lower stiffness compared to high modulus sealants. This property allows the silicone to accommodate movement and expansion without cracking or losing its adhesive properties, making it ideal for applications where joints are subject to constant stress and deformation.

Neutral cure, on the other hand, refers to the curing process of the silicone. Unlike acetoxy cure silicone, which releases acetic acid during curing and can cause corrosion on certain materials, neutral cure silicone cures without releasing any harmful by-products. This makes it safe to use on a wide range of substrates, including metals, plastics, glass, and concrete, without the risk of damaging the surface.

One of the main advantages of low modulus neutral cure silicone is its excellent weather resistance. LMNCS is highly resistant to UV radiation, extreme temperatures, moisture, and chemicals, making it suitable for both interior and exterior applications. Whether it is sealing windows, installing solar panels, or waterproofing joints in a swimming pool, LMNCS provides long-lasting protection against the elements and maintains its performance over time.

Another key benefit of low modulus neutral cure silicone is its superior adhesion properties. LMNCS forms a strong bond with a variety of materials and surfaces, ensuring a secure and durable seal. Whether it is bonding metal panels, sealing gaps in concrete structures, or installing sanitary fittings, LMNCS provides a reliable and long-lasting solution for various construction and repair projects.

In addition to its weather resistance and adhesion properties, low modulus neutral cure silicone offers excellent flexibility and movement capability. LMNCS can stretch and compress to accommodate joint movements without tearing or becoming detached, making it an ideal choice for applications where dynamic stress is present. This flexibility ensures that the seal remains intact and watertight, even under extreme conditions, providing added peace of mind to professionals and homeowners alike.

Furthermore, low modulus neutral cure silicone is easy to apply and work with, thanks to its smooth and non-sag consistency. LMNCS can be easily dispensed using a caulking gun and tooled to create a neat and professional finish. Its fast curing time allows for quick and efficient installation, saving time and labor costs on construction sites and repair projects.
